11 killed, 58 injured, in Baghdad car bomb blast

A car bomb exploded in eastern Baghdad today, killing at least 11 people and wounding another 58.

The bomb detonated in a large square used mostly as a car park near the main headquarters of Baghdad’s traffic police department, said police Cap. Mohammed Abdel-Ghani.

At least two of the dead were traffic police officers.

In past years, the square was used for driving tests.
